Thanks for the patch! See 4 comments below. On 30.03.2021 13:21, Mergen Imeev via Tarantool-patches wrote: > Prior to this patch string passed to user-defined C-function from SQL > was cropped in case it contains '\0'. At the same time, it wasn't > cropped if it is passed to the function from BOX. Now it isn't cropped > when passed from SQL. > > Part of #5938 > --- > diff --git a/test/sql-tap/gh-5938-wrong-string-length.c b/test/sql-tap/gh-5938-wrong-string-length.c > new file mode 100644 > index 000000000..96823f049 > --- /dev/null > +++ b/test/sql-tap/gh-5938-wrong-string-length.c > @@ -0,0 +1,42 @@ > +#include <msgpuck.h> 1. We use "" for non-system headers, not <>. > +#include "module.h" > + > +enum > +{ 2. Enums have { on the same line as 'enum'. > + BUF_SIZE = 512, > +}; > + > +int > +ret_str(box_function_ctx_t *ctx, const char *args, const char *args_end) > +{ > + uint32_t arg_count = mp_decode_array(&args); > + if (arg_count != 1) { > + return box_error_set(__FILE__, __LINE__, ER_PROC_C, "%s", > + "invalid argument count"); 3. You don't need "%s", you can pass the error message right away. 4. The expression is misaligned. The same for the other box_error_set(). > + } > + if (mp_typeof(*args) != MP_STR) { > + return box_error_set(__FILE__, __LINE__, ER_PROC_C, "%s", > + "argument should be string"); > + } > + const char* str; > + uint32_t str_n; > + str = mp_decode_str(&args, &str_n); > + > + uint32_t size = mp_sizeof_array(1) + mp_sizeof_str(str_n); > + if (size > BUF_SIZE) { > + return box_error_set(__FILE__, __LINE__, ER_PROC_C, "%s", > + "string is too long"); > + }
